Switch Mode

__full__ Download Microsoft Visual — Basic For Applications Core Exclusive

| Your Status | Action Required | | :--- | :--- | | | Install Microsoft 365 Apps for enterprise. The VBA Core comes free with it (but not exclusive). | | Paid Developer | Log into Visual Studio Subscription portal. Search for "VBA 7.1 SDK." Download the exclusive MSI. | | IT Admin | Use Volume Licensing Service Center + Office Deployment Tool to push VBA components. | | Someone with a broken VBA | Run Office repair ( Control Panel > Programs > Change > Repair ). Do not download standalone DLLs. |

Once your VBA Core files are properly configured, follow these guidelines to keep your automation environment secure: | Your Status | Action Required | |

Run the official Vba71.msi or similar installer provided directly by that software vendor. Best Practices for VBA Security and Stability Search for "VBA 7

Abstract This paper explains what Microsoft Visual Basic for Applications (VBA) Core is, its typical use cases, licensing and availability, and detailed, practical guidance on obtaining and installing VBA components relevant to end users and developers. The goal is to provide a clear, structured, and actionable resource for readers who want to enable or use VBA for automating tasks in Microsoft Office and other host applications. Do not download standalone DLLs

If VBA is missing (e.g., you get "Visual Basic for Applications is not installed" errors), you need to modify your Office installation.

Expand , find Visual Basic for Applications , and set it to Run from My Computer . Click Continue to finish the installation. 3. Download Official Security Updates